Four years ago, Flight Centre’s global CMO Megan Henderson was tasked with leading a sweeping restructure of Flight Centre’s worldwide marketing operation – centralising five teams into one while overhauling its martech stack and contracts and simultaneously finding efficiencies and growth. Daunting. But Henderson knew that Fight Centre’s 60 million annual unique online visitors, broad customer comms channels yielding rich first party data plus circa 400 physical stores could help drive the business into fresh territory – adjacent travel market services beyond flights – while generating revenue via owned media packaged and sold to new and existing brand partners. Enter owned media valuations specialist, Sonder, which dived deep to benchmark and calculate the value of each and all of Flight Centres channels and assets – and highlight where it could go next as an owned media network. Now Henderson aims to make Flight Centre a global case study in how customers, data, physical and digital footprint combine to drive growth, revenue, profit and cross-funnel, cross-category expansion – while landing new paying partners. It’s now rolling out screens across all stores to boost brand building capability and link it through to first party data-powered conversion. “Having Sonder shine a light on what we could be doing with our digital screens has really fast-tracked the process for us to make sure that our stores have a minimum of two digital screens that I can use for brand advertising with all kinds of partners,” says Henderson. She’s now ensuring partners think of Flight Centre “as a mass market retailer with millions of customers online and in store… and see that as an opportunity that they can't get with a standard media buying mix.” Sonder co-founder, Jonathan Hopkins, says that’s the key takeout for businesses currently leaving money on the table by overlooking their owned media channels and assets: “There is vast opportunity out there. If you have a website, store network, an email program with a sizeable customer base, then you're more than halfway there to building an owned media proposition to leverage through your own marketing and with brand partners,” says Hopkins. “It’s all about seizing the opportunity.”See omnystudio.com/listener for privacy information.
Julie Nestor was one of the earliest Australian marketers to leverage owned media at scale, first at Optus and American Express and now – via Hilton Hotels and eBay – at Mastercard. The APAC marketing chief says owned media helped Optus get beyond mobile and into broader media and communications – and moved the needle for Amex, both in bringing on more merchant partners and driving customer loyalty, retention and spend through personalised offers. Now she says it is “by far” Mastercard's most efficient channel via the ‘Priceless' platform, with priceless.com both monetised and serving as the engine room for Mastercard and its main business partners – i.e. the big banks and their customers. Hence the firm continuing to invest heavily in owned media – everything from offsetting paid investment into its Australian Open partnership to building gaming platforms for banks and fintechs in Asia, to helping Ukrainian refugees find homes. But while owned media strategies today are increasingly sophisticated, the fundamentals remain the same as at Optus 20 years ago – which back then leveraged analogue customer bills to cross-sell. “Be where your customers are and where you are going to get most attention,” says Nestor. Likewise, understanding the value of owned channels is key. Nestor worked with specialist owned media consultancy Sonder at Amex and again at Mastercard. Quantifying “real dollar figures” with “measurable numbers” both internally and externally to partners, she says, is critical in maximising leverage and underlining “how marketing supports a business to grow revenue”. Sonder ran an owned media valuation audit for Mastercard across 10 markets, benchmarking metrics such as “click-throughs, time on site, sell-through” against “our $10 billion rate pool, which gives us a single source of truth” for owned asset value, per co-founder Angus Frazer. Having worked with the likes of ANZ, Amex and Mastercard, Sonder's Jonathan Hopkins thinks the finance sector is about to show the retail media sector just how powerful owned media can be – given its “unparalleled data” and massive footprint. “It's the tip of the iceberg,” says Hopkins. “They are already way ahead of other companies.”See omnystudio.com/listener for privacy information.
Owned media in Australia – brands' own websites, email, apps, instore and social assets – now has $4.3bn in commercial potential. It could reach $5bn in as little as 12 months as brands, eyeing the growth of retail media, start to realise the value of their own media channels. Valuation firm Sonder has just released its annual Owned Media Market Report & Rankings for the '24 financial year and it again contextualises the retail media boom - retailers might be making all the noise around retailer media networks but they represent just one-third of the commercial value that brands across any sector can derive from their own media channels. Mike Connaghan, MD of News Corp's Commercial Content division, says his business is booming as the likes of Coles, Bunnings, Officeworks, David Jones and Chemist Warehouse make media revenue from suppliers and use it to fund their own paid marketing efforts as well as turn a healthy margin. Owned media specialist Sonder is seeing the same thing. The likes of ANZ have reorganised operations to put owned channels first – and co-founder Angus Frazer thinks more will follow, especially as pressure on marketing budgets intensifies. Sonder has run the rule over Australia's owned media sector and drops some well-informed hints at numbers on which brands and businesses might be coming to market next. In retail media, Sonder says the ones to watch are Bunnings, Accent Group, JB-Hi-Fi, Mecca and Kmart. In grocery and liquor it's First Choice and Vintage Cellars, while in finance its Visa and Mastercard. Sonder co-founder Jonathan Hopkins says the broader market is now “at a tipping point” as brands realise they can better engage, upsell and cross-sell to existing customers, and use the income from selling or trading space with their suppliers to fund acquisition bucket filling.See omnystudio.com/listener for privacy information.
David Jones' new retail media business wants brand budgets – both from the suppliers it already works with as well as wooing marketers across travel, automotive and lifestyle. CMO James Holloman is backing shopper data from 5.4 million premium David Jones customers – and the ability to hyper-target them across DJs stores and digital assets as well as across the open web – in a plan to woo marketers to spend with its new Amplify media unit. Years in the making, Holloman needed to convince powerful merchandising teams to cede control of how they strike deals with suppliers while building a tech stack from scratch and centralising control of its sprawling assets. Now the marketing-run Amplify has its own P&L and great management expectations. Jonathan Hopkins, whose firm Sonder helped value DJ's assets and develop the media business, says the average department store retailer in Australia could make $34m annually from media. But that's the average, and DJs is top-end, with 55m annual store visits and 110m hits to its website. It's loyalty data-powered offsite media revenue could be significant but Holloman's not putting a figure out there, and shies away from any suggestion it's a ‘Cartology for premium shoppers'. “It's early days,” he says. “But we've got ambitious targets.” Here's how Australia's oldest retailer got into the newest, fastest-growing media game in town – and where it's headed next.See omnystudio.com/listener for privacy information.

Cartology has made the early running and noise in the bustling supermarket media category but ‘owned' media – that is, all media and audience assets controlled by a brand – is at least three times the size of the grocery and liquor sector. And ‘retail aggregators' (think Officeworks, BigW, Myer and JB Hi-Fi) is nearly 20 per cent bigger than the grocery sector, according to Sonder via a new report, hot off the press. The firm calculates Australia's owned media potential stands at $3.9bn – and 80-90 per cent margins have CEOs and CFOs licking their lips. That could alter the balance of power between marketing, sales and merchandise, and potentially change the dynamics between paid, owned and earned investment. Founding partners Jonathan Hopkins and Angus Frazer run the rule over five standout categories – grocery and liquor, aggregated retail, telco, petrol and convenience, and finance – which players may be next to market (hint, anyone with a loyalty programme) and the implications for Australian media market dynamics.See omnystudio.com/listener for privacy information.

In 2003, the billionaire former owner of Harrods, Mohamed Al-Fayed, tasked Guy Cheston with building a media business for the department store. By 2015, the luxury store's media worked so well it paid for everything else. “Initially, this media sales or the owned media division was really just a little tiny element of the trade marketing team,” he says. “Harrods had set up its own in-house media division, which was funding the entire marketing function of the store.” It went from £1m to £22m in a bit over a decade, and then went skyward. Not every brand is Harrods, but those that nail owned media can make serious cash. First step: Valuing what's available.Jonathan Hopkins, Founding Partner of owned media consultancy Sonder, says the reaction tends to be: “‘Wow, I didn't realise we were sitting on a $150 million worth of own media'… Once it's given that dollar amount and valuation, it changes the way that the business views the channels,” he says. “When you're talking about profit margins of 80 to 90 per cent, CEOs and CFOs are going to stand up and take notice.” See omnystudio.com/listener for privacy information.

Jonathan Hopkins is no stranger to the exquisite art of writing (sic). He began writing poetry at the age of 14 and continues to write over 35 years later. He has penned several short stories and over 200 pieces that range in style from sonnet to modern spoken word. His book, “Golden Dreams on Copper Wings: Life's Flight Through Poetry” is a retrospective, often humorous, look at his life through the eyes of his pen. Jonathan was a fixture in the Washington DC area poetry scene under the Pseudonym “The Wryte One.” His peers have described him/his work as “genius,” “... one of the most prolific and fanatically-flowing writers I've met,” “neurotic word-play,” ”the definition of poetry,” as well as countless other superlatives. Jonathan is also a gifted guitarist who has been playing since the age of 16. He has played with a plethora of local artists, performed in numerous venues, worked on several recorded projects and has even shared the stage with Eric Benet. Jonathan hopes to express his life, his love and his Lord Jesus Christ through his gifts of writing and music.
